This repository contains the trained models of the publication: |
|
|
|
|
|
Portalés-Julià, Enrique and Mateo-García, Gonzalo and Gómez-Chova, Luis, [**Understanding Flood Detection Models Across Sentinel-1 and Sentinel-2 Modalities and Benchmark Datasets.**](https://www.sciencedirect.com/science/article/pii/S003442572500286X#bib1), published in Remote Sensing of Environment. |
|
|
|
|
|
We include the trained models: |
|
|
* **sm_unet_s2** Model trained on the Sentinel-2 L1C bands `["B02", "B03", "B04", "B08", "B11", "B12"]` from the S1S2Water and WorldFloods datasets. |
|
|
* **sm_unet_s1** Model trained on the Sentinel-1 GRD data (`[VV, VH]` channels) from the S1S2Water and Kuro Siwo datasets. |
|
|
* **mm_unet_s1s2** Dual stream with modality token model, trained on the S1S2Water (Sentinel-1 GRD and Sentinel-2 L1C data), WorldFloods (Sentinel-2 L1C) and Kuro Siwo Sentinel-1 GRD data. |
